The EF ECOFLOW DELTA 3 is a compact and quiet portable power station designed for those who need reliable power on the go, whether for camping, RV trips, or emergency home backup. It delivers a solid 1800W continuous power output, making it capable of running multiple small appliances simultaneously—up to 13 devices at once. This makes it quite versatile compared to many other small generators. The lithium iron phosphate (LiFePO4) battery technology used here is notable for its long lifespan, rated at about 4000 charging cycles, meaning it should last around 10 years with regular use.
Charging is impressively fast, with a full charge achievable in under an hour via AC power or solar input, which adds to its efficiency and convenience. Its noise level is very low, staying under 30 decibels at 600W output, so it won’t disturb your peace in outdoor or quiet environments. Portability-wise, it weighs about 27.5 pounds (12.5 kg), which is somewhat heavy for a portable generator but still manageable for short-distance transport. It also features inverter technology, ensuring clean and stable power suitable for sensitive electronics. The unit offers various outlets including AC and USB-C, making it easy to connect different types of devices.
A potential downside is that the unit's size and weight might limit how portable it feels compared to smaller gas-powered generators, and since it relies on electric power (battery), runtime depends on the battery capacity and recharging options rather than continuous fuel burning. This power station is well-suited for users who prioritize quiet operation, fast recharge, and clean power for sensitive devices, especially in camping or emergency backup scenarios.
The EF ECOFLOW DELTA2 solar generator is a strong choice if you're looking for a quiet, eco-friendly power source for camping, RV trips, or home backup. It provides up to 1800 watts of power, enough to run most household appliances and outdoor gear. What stands out is its clean solar charging capability with a 220W bifacial solar panel, which captures more sunlight and lets you recharge off-grid. This means you avoid noisy, smelly gas generators. The LFP (LiFePO4) battery is designed to last a long time, with over 3000 charge cycles, so you won't need to replace it often. It also supports fast AC charging and can be expanded with extra batteries if you need more power, up to 3kWh total.
With 15 outlets, it offers flexible connectivity for multiple devices. On the portability front, the DELTA2 is lighter and easier to handle than traditional generators, but at 58 pounds, it’s still somewhat heavy, so not ideal for very long hikes. The main downsides to consider are the initial cost, and that the solar panel and power station ship separately, which might be a minor hassle.
This model is an excellent silent and sustainable generator option if you want reliable power without fuel or noise, especially in outdoor or emergency settings.
The Jackery HomePower 3600 Plus is a high-capacity portable power station designed mainly for home backup, emergencies, and RV use. It offers a strong 3600W continuous output, enough to run larger appliances like pumps and dryers, which makes it suitable for small households during power outages. Its large 3584Wh battery can be expanded significantly, giving flexibility for longer backup needs. Since it’s battery-powered with no traditional fuel, it operates quietly and cleanly, avoiding the noise and fumes common in gas generators. This battery uses advanced technology to ensure safety and a long lifespan, and it can handle extreme temperatures well.
For charging, the unit is versatile, supporting solar panels, AC outlets, and even gas generators, with fast recharge times especially when combining AC and DC inputs. One of its biggest advantages is portability despite its size—it's lighter and smaller than similar models, with wheels and a handle making it easier to move around. However, it still weighs over 77 pounds, which might be heavy for some users to carry without help. The unit provides standard 120V outlets and can work in parallel for 240V, catering well to typical home appliances.
A potential downside is the price, and the product’s appeal may be niche due to competition in the market. This generator is well suited for those seeking a quiet, powerful, and reliable electric backup option who value clean energy and portability, though they should consider its weight and investment cost.
